《误差理论与测量平差》
上机实验报告
专业: 测绘工程
班级: 测绘082
姓名:
测绘工程学院
测绘工程系
实验报告一:条件平差法上机
一、目的与要求
利用Matlab软件,通过算例(详见教材P81例4-5)熟练掌握条件平差法数据输入的项目及特点;
熟练掌握根据中间结果计算平差值并进行精度评定。
二、任务
1、完成算例(详见教材P81例4-5)基本信息量及条件方程系数矩阵A、常数项矩阵W、观测值向量协因数阵Q各元素的输入;
2、组成法方程并计算观测值改正数V、改正数向量V的协因数阵QVV、观测量平差值向量的协因数阵;
3、计算单位权中误差M0及P1至P2点间高差平差值中误差;
4、完成给定题目的数据输入及平差计算全过程,根据要求计算相关量的平差值及中误差
三、在如图所示的水准网中,A点为已知点,HA=,P1~P4为待定点,设各路线长度分别为S1=2Km,S2=3Km,S3=1Km,S4=3Km,S5=4Km设水准网中每公里观测高差的精度相同;观测高差为:h1=,h2=,h3= ,h4=,h5=。
试按条件平差法求:
1、各段高差的平差值;
2、各待定点的高程平差值;
3、单位权中误差;
4、各待定点高程平差值中误差。
解:(1)本题有5个观测值,必要观测数为3,水准网条件方程个数为2,有图可列立条件方程如下:
v1 - v2 + v4 + 2 = 0
v3 - v4 + v5 – 6 = 0
(2)将上述条件方程用矩阵表达,执行MATLAB,在命令窗口输入下列矩阵:
条件方程的系数 A=[1 -1 0 1 0;0 0 1 -3 1]
常系数 W=[2;-6]
权逆阵 Q=[2 0 0 0 0;0 3 0 0 0;0 0 1 0 0;0 0 0 3 0;0 0 0 0 4]
高差观测值 L=[;;;;]
权系数 f1=[-1;0;0;0;0]
f2=[0;0;0;1;0]
f3=[0;0;1;0;0]
(3)以下是计算过程:
法方程系数阵 N=A*Q*A'
8 -9
-9 32
解联系数 K=-inv(N)*W
-
求改正数 V=Q*A'*K
-
-
求平差值 LL=L+V/1000
最或然高程值 Hp1=-
Hp2= +
Hp3=+
单位权中误差 m0=sqrt(V'*inv(Q)*V/2)
平差值函数中误差 m1=m0*sqrt(f1'*(Q-Q*A'*inv(N)*A*Q)*f1)
m2=m0*sqrt(f2'*(Q-Q*A'*inv(N)*A*Q)*f2)
m3=m0*sqrt(f3'*(Q-Q*A'*inv(N)*A*Q)*f3)
成绩: 指导教师: 宁伟日期: 2010 年 5 月 15 日
实验报告二:间接平差法上机
一、目的与要求
1、利用Matlab软件,通过算例(详见教材P102例5-6)熟练掌握间接平差法数据输入的项目及特点;
熟练掌握根据中间结果计算平差值并进行精度评定。
二、任务
1、完成算例(详见教材P102例5-6)基本信息量及误差方程系数矩阵B、常数项矩阵L、观测值向量权阵P各元素的输入;
2、组成法方程并计算观测值改正数V、未知数近似值改正数x,向量V、x的协因数阵QVV、Qxx观测量平差值向量的协因数阵;
3、计算单位权中误差M0;
4、计算P1至P2点间高差平差值中误差及待定点高程平差值中误差;
5、完成给定题目的数据输入及平差计算全过程,根据要求计算相关量的平差值及中误差。
三、在如图所示的水准网中,测得各点间的高差及距离分别为
h1= S1=1km h2= S2=1km
h3= S3=1km h4= S4=1km
h5=- S5=2km 定权时,设C=1。
试求:1)已知点自定,求各待定点高程平差值及其中误差;
2)平差后AB两点间高差平差值及其中误差;
3)平差后AC两点间高差平差值中误差。
解:本题有5个观测值,必要观测数为
测量平差基础上机实验报告 来自淘豆网m.daumloan.com转载请标明出处.